Mac安装sdk环境以及ionic项目的运行及打包

本文详细介绍如何在Mac上安装并配置Ionic开发环境,包括安装Android Studio、配置Android SDK环境变量、安装Ionic和Cordova等步骤,以及解决常见问题的方法。

摘要生成于 C知道 ,由 DeepSeek-R1 满血版支持, 前往体验 >

ionic是一个hybrid APP开发框架,本文主要讲述的是mac上安装sdk环境,然后用ionic打包安卓和ios。

安装android studio

网上查了一下,有说用homebrew安装的,有的说直接解压的,我尝试用homebrew安装,但最后没有跑起来,然后走了一个捷径,android studio在运行时,首先就需要下载sdk。(jdk也需要安装,这里就不做说明了)。

可以在这里下载android studio。

安装完成后,打开android studio就会让你下载sdk和ndk以及安卓模拟器,直接点击下载即可。在下载sdk的时候,会让你选择一个文件夹,记好这个地址,后面配置sdk地址需要。

配置android地址

~/.bash_profile

文件里配置ANDROID_HOME和以及需要的工具:

export ANDROID_HOME=/Users/dxy-ly/Library/Android/sdk
export PATH=${PATH}:$ANDROID_HOME/tools:$ANDROID_HOME/platform-tools

然后运行

source ~/.bash_profile

使配置生效。

安装ionic和cordova

mac上自带npm,不需要安装了,可以使用

sudo npm install -g npm

来更新npm,然后安装ionic和cordova

(sudo) npm install -g ionic cordova

然后可以新建一个工程(默认都是ionic2了)

ionic start newProject

添加android环境

cd newProject
ionic platform android

编译生成apk文件

ionic build android

如果上步编译有问题,可以这样处理:参考

cd ~/Library/Android/sdk
# download latest tools
curl -O https://dl.google.com/android/repository/tools_r25.2.3-macosx.zip
# overwrite existing tools folder without prompting
unzip -o tools_r25.2.3-macosx.zip
# clean up
rm tools_r25.2.3-macosx.zip

然后可以在模拟器中跑起来

ionic emulate android

但我在模拟器中,没有跑起来,目前还没找到原因,等找到原因再补充。但一般模拟器比较慢,还是用手机测试方便些。

评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包

打赏作者

Chocolyte

你的鼓励将是我创作的最大动力

¥1 ¥2 ¥4 ¥6 ¥10 ¥20
扫码支付:¥1
获取中
扫码支付

您的余额不足,请更换扫码支付或充值

打赏作者

实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值